Desde el nivel API 9 (2.3) se puede establecer una alarma mediante una intención:Establecer una alarma (como en el despertador) usando las intenciones
Intent i = new Intent(AlarmClock.ACTION_SET_ALARM);
i.putExtra(AlarmClock.EXTRA_HOUR, 9);
i.putExtra(AlarmClock.EXTRA_MINUTES, 37);
startActivity(i);
¿Hay alguna forma de establecer una alarma de forma similar (sin papeles ¿API?) Para niveles de API más bajos?
Además, si alguien conoce algún método similar para los relojes de alarma sin stock (such as ones listed here I.E. HTC Despertador, Despertador de Desenfoque Moto, etc ...) Lo agradecería mucho.
AlarmManager no se usa para configurar la alarma del reloj, sino que se usa para programar la ejecución de servicios. Es molesto que solo tenga el nombre que esperas para configurar la alarma. – stealthcopter